Company Description
Founded in 1952 and formerly known as Heery International Inc., the firm operates throughout the United States as part of Turner & Townsend. It specializes in project and program management for public sector organizations, with industry-leading experts in corporate, cultural, healthcare, justice, sports, K-12 education, higher education, aviation and government facilities.
Recognized for service excellence by a broad spectrum of professional organizations and industry publications, the talented multidisciplinary team at Turner & Townsend Heery exceeds client expectations — adding value, best practice and expertise at every turn. The team's unique client-centric culture is integrated into each project and reflects a passion for the built environment and staying true to the client’s vision.
Job Description
Turner & Townsend Heery is seeking an experienced Facilities Project Manager Small Projects Repair & Maintenance to monitor construction projects valued at $5 million or less for clients, with direct accountability for project delivery.
The Facilities Project Manager Small Projects Repair & Maintenance shall manage all facets of project management on urban government campus for individual projects while protecting the client’s best interests in a manner that will facilitate delivering quality projects on-time and with-in budget.
Location: Full time, on site in Richmond, VA
Responsibilities:
- Provides overall management and administration of pre-design, design, and construction and commissioning services.
- Confirms that appropriate project authorization and funding is in place before activities begin; prepare cash flow projections and monitors financial performance.
- Assures that all necessary jurisdictional approvals are obtained and that all applicable codes and standards are met.
- Diligently pursues the timely completion of any punch list and project closeout activities.
- Provides overall project cost control, schedule management and quality assurance for projects from the design phase through project closeout.
- Anticipates potential problems that may jeopardize project success and identifies alternative solutions.
- Assures that projects adhere to approved scope, are completed within budget, on schedule and at the prescribed level of quality.
- Maintains project records and produces various reports.
- Maintains critical project information in an automated project management system on a continuous basis.
- Provides leadership to various individuals associated with each project.
- Manages and/or coordinates activities of technical discipline team members, specialty consultants, construction inspectors, and project support staff.
- Partners with planners during scope development, cost estimates and project scheduling and may assist maintenance and operation staff with warranty compliance.
- Works closely with client representatives on a day-to-day basis.
- Administers the process of selecting design professionals, consultants and contractors to design and construct projects.
- This includes preparing scopes of work, soliciting for services, evaluating credentials and interviewing potential contractors, evaluating references and past performance, and negotiating fees and services.

Qualifications
Education and Experience
- A bachelor’s degree in Architecture, Engineering, or Construction Management or related field.
- Minimum of five (5) years of progressively responsible related experience, which includes managing multiple renovation projects, (under $2 Million) and/or new construction projects. Experience should also include managing A/E (design) consultant services and construction administration.
- Must have been in a position, which demonstrates independent decision-making.
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:
- Possess thorough knowledge of design and construction management practices.
- Ability to independently manage and coordinate multiple design and construction projects.
- Ability to effectively communicate (in oral and written form) and to use a computer for email, correspondence, reports, spreadsheets and automated project management systems. Ability to create management reports.
